Runbook: Kiosk watchdog — account recovery. New folks: the Pebblemere kiosks run a watchdog that reboots the shell if the UI freezes for 45 seconds. Sometimes it reboots mid-login and the kiosk service account gets locked out. Don't reimage the device — that loses queued orders. Instead, boot into the maintenance shell, pick "restore service account," and wait for the prompt. When it asks, enter the recovery passphrase below.

recovery phrase for fajep-yaweg: gilath-sorox-wenius-rusdor-keliel-zorius

## Deployment — LeafLoop Greenhouse Controller

Heads up: the humidity sensors in Bay 3 drift upward after about two weeks, so the controller applies a rolling recalibration offset. Don't disable it unless you've swapped the sensors. Deploy with the standard script, then confirm the drift-correction job is running. The controller boots with the configuration below.

config for kagup-hahig:
druwyn:
  pin: 2801
  metrics_host: metrics.druwyn.zemvarlabs.internal
  tenant: sorius
  seal: seal_798a43d7

**Ticket SPOOL-442: Duplicate job headers in PrintWeave spooler**

Plugin authors targeting the PrintWeave microservice should note that jobs submitted through the v3 intake endpoint occasionally emit duplicate header blocks when retries overlap. The fix lands in the next minor release; until then, set your retry backoff above two seconds. Reproduction requires the staging spooler at Hartwell Labs. The affected build is identified by the token below.

pipeline stamp: htk9_6ce9d33c5

## Deploying the Gatewick Proctor Queue

Deploys are pretty painless: push to main, wait for the pipeline, then watch the queue drain dashboard for five minutes. If candidates pile up mid-exam, roll back first and ask questions later — the queue replays safely. Everything the workers care about lives in one config block, shown here for reference.

settings of bafof-yagef:
JOROX_PIN=8740
JOROX_TENANT=pelox
JOROX_METRICS_HOST=metrics.jorox.qorvelworks.internal
JOROX_SEAL=seal_c78f63c1
JOROX_STANDBY_TEAM=norax